We are currently adding support for XLIFF files to QA Distiller, a stand-alone translation quality control tool.

It would be great if the XLIFF files exported from Sisulizer would have the SL namespace defined so we can process Sisulizer XLIFF files without additional pre-processing.

Currently, because the namespace prefix SL is not declared, the XML parser we use considers XLIFF files from Sisulizer to be invalid.
